It is our pleasure and honor to be the Editor-in-Chief of the Pacific Asia Journal of the Association for Information Systems (PAJAIS). After cultivating over a decade, PAJAIS has become an important platform for researchers to share their high-quality papers. The mission of PAJAIS is to be a leading IS journal. Although the journal intends to have close ties with the communities in Asia Pacific regions, it is an open platform that welcomes submissions on any IS-related topics from authors around the world. In order to provide readers with a better understanding of the profile of PAJAIS, this editorial is the first in the series to summarize what has been published. Our founding editor, Prof. Ting-Peng Liang, and I started this series with a discussion of the publications in PAJAIS.
